Before you read
What will you get from this book?
Winner of an AJN Book of the Year Award for 2009! Chapters include: A Framework for Quality Nursing Practice Caring for Patients and Families Teaching Quality-Caring Evaluating Quality-Caring A crucial component to nursing excellence is the development and maintenance of a positive, caring relationship between the nurse and patient. Before this book, all other caring texts have been solely theoretical. Quality Care is the first to apply theoretical knowledge of caring in a practical way. Clear and concise charts, forms, illustrations, tables, and decision trees present essential information to guide treatment planning and documentation. Duffy also explains how to implement her very own Quality-Caring Model, which combines evidence-based practice with caring. Each chapter contains key terms, case studies, references to support further research, and application chapters also contain useful exercises for nurses.
